zk-SNARKs teknolojisinin sektör araştırması ve uygulama geleceği analizi
zk-SNARKs ( ZKP ), öncü bir kriptografi teknolojisi olarak, blockchain ve Web3 alanında giderek daha önemli bir rol oynamaktadır. Bu makalede ZKP'nin teknik prensipleri, uygulama senaryoları, ekosistem yapısı gibi birçok boyuttan kapsamlı bir analizi yapılacaktır.
Bir. zk-SNARKs'in Temel Kavramı
zk-SNARKs, ek herhangi bir ek bilgi sızdırmadan bir ifadenin doğru olduğunu kanıtlayabilen bir kriptografi tekniğidir. Üç temel özelliğe sahiptir:
Bütünlük: Eğer beyan doğruysa, doğrulayıcı ikna edilebilir.
Güvenilirlik: Eğer beyan yanlışsa, doğrulayıcı aldatılmayacaktır.
Sıfır Bilgi: Doğrulayıcı, beyanın kendisinin doğruluğu dışında hiçbir ek bilgi almaz.
ZKP'nin temel katılımcıları, (Prover) ve (Verifier) olan kanıtlayıcı ve doğrulayıcıdır. Kanıtlayıcı, doğrulayıcıya belirli bilgilere sahip olduğunu veya bildiğini kanıtlamak zorundadır, ancak belirli ayrıntıları ifşa etmeden.
İkincisi, zk-SNARKs'in Ana Türleri
Şu anda, zk-SNARKs esas olarak iki ana kategoriye ayrılmaktadır:
Etkileşimli kanıt: Doğrulamanın tamamlanabilmesi için kanıtlayıcı ve doğrulayıcı arasında birden fazla etkileşim gereklidir.
Etkileşimsiz kanıt: Sadece bir etkileşimle doğrulama tamamlanabilir, bu da onu blockchain gibi senaryolar için daha uygun hale getirir.
Yaygın ZKP sistemleri şunlardır:
zk-SNARK: Kısa ve etkileşimsiz bilgi kanıtı, yüksek hesaplama verimliliğine sahip ancak güvenilir bir kurulum gerektirir.
zk-STARK: Ölçeklenebilir şeffaf bilgi kanıtı, güvenilir ayar gerektirmiyor ama kanıt boyutu büyük.
Bulletproofs: Güvenilir bir kurulum gerektirmeyen, gizli işlemler gibi senaryolar için uygun, sade ZKP.
Üç, zk-SNARKs'in teknik prensipleri
ZKP'nin temel fikri, hesaplama problemlerini çok terimli problemlere dönüştürmektir. Ana adımlar şunlardır:
Devreyi R1CS( Rank-1 Kısıtlama Sistemi) olarak dönüştür
R1CS'yi QAP(Kare Aritmetik Programına)dönüştür
Homomorfik şifreleme için çift dostu eliptik eğriler kullanma
Rastgele zorluklar kullanarak bilgi çıkarımı gerçekleştirmek
zk-SNARK ve zk-STARK gibi sistemlerin somut uygulamalarında farklılıklar vardır, ancak temel prensipleri benzer.
Dört, zk-SNARKs Uygulama Senaryoları
ZKP'nin blok zinciri alanında geniş bir uygulama potansiyeli vardır:
Ölçeklenebilirlik: ZK Rollup gibi Layer 2 çözümleri ile verimliliği artırmak
Gizlilik Koruma: Gizli işlemler, gizli akıllı sözleşmeler vb. gerçekleştirme
Kimlik Doğrulama: KYC gibi doğrulamaları hassas bilgileri ifşa etmeden tamamlayabilirsiniz.
Zincirler Arası İşlem: Güvenli ve Verimli Zincirler Arası İletişimi Gerçekleştirmek
Oyun ve Metaverse: Oyun adaletini artırmak, sanal varlıkların gizliliğini korumak
Tedarik Zinciri Yönetimi: Ticari sırları korurken izlenebilirlik sağlama
Dijital Kimlik: Kendi Kendine Egemen Kimlik ( Self-Sovereign Identity )
Beş, zk-SNARKs ekosisteminin genel görünümü
Şu anda ZKP ekosistemi esasen aşağıdaki birkaç proje türünü içermektedir:
Altyapı: Mina, Aleo gibi
Ölçeklenebilirlik çözümleri: zkSync, StarkNet gibi
Gizlilik Koruma: Zcash, Tornado Cash gibi.
Geliştirme Araçları: circom, snarkjs vb.
Uygulama projeleri: Örneğin Polygon zkEVM, Scroll vb.
Ana akım halka açık blok zincirleri, Ethereum gibi, ZKP teknolojisini aktif bir şekilde benimsemekte ve bunu gelecekteki genişleme için önemli bir yön olarak görmektedir.
Altı, zk-SNARKs'in Zorlukları ve Geleceği
ZKP teknolojisi geniş bir geleceğe sahip olmasına rağmen, hala bazı zorluklarla karşı karşıya.
Performans optimizasyonu: Kanıt üretim süresini ve doğrulama maliyetini azaltma
Kullanım Kolaylığı: Geliştirme sürecini basitleştirir, kullanım engelini azaltır.
Standartlaştırma: Birleşik standartlar oluşturmak, birlikte çalışabilirliği teşvik etmek
Güvenlik: Kuantum hesaplama gibi potansiyel tehditlere karşı koymak
Düzenleyici Uyum: Gizlilik Koruma ile Düzenleyici İhtiyaçlar Arasında Denge
Gelecekte, teknolojinin sürekli ilerlemesi ve ekosistemin giderek daha da mükemmel hale gelmesiyle, ZKP'nin daha fazla alanda önemli bir rol oynaması ve blockchain ile Web3'ün büyük ölçekli uygulamalarını teşvik etmesi bekleniyor.
This page may contain third-party content, which is provided for information purposes only (not representations/warranties) and should not be considered as an endorsement of its views by Gate, nor as financial or professional advice. See Disclaimer for details.
13 Likes
Reward
13
4
Share
Comment
0/400
BankruptWorker
· 7h ago
Ne zaman zk'yi anlayabileceğim?
View OriginalReply0
mev_me_maybe
· 8h ago
Bu teknoloji ne zaman hayata geçecek?
View OriginalReply0
SatoshiChallenger
· 8h ago
tuzak yüksek kaliteli bir deri, tarih sadece tekrar ediyor.
zk-SNARKs: Web3 geleceğinin temel teknolojisi ve uygulama perspektifinin analizi
zk-SNARKs teknolojisinin sektör araştırması ve uygulama geleceği analizi
zk-SNARKs ( ZKP ), öncü bir kriptografi teknolojisi olarak, blockchain ve Web3 alanında giderek daha önemli bir rol oynamaktadır. Bu makalede ZKP'nin teknik prensipleri, uygulama senaryoları, ekosistem yapısı gibi birçok boyuttan kapsamlı bir analizi yapılacaktır.
Bir. zk-SNARKs'in Temel Kavramı
zk-SNARKs, ek herhangi bir ek bilgi sızdırmadan bir ifadenin doğru olduğunu kanıtlayabilen bir kriptografi tekniğidir. Üç temel özelliğe sahiptir:
ZKP'nin temel katılımcıları, (Prover) ve (Verifier) olan kanıtlayıcı ve doğrulayıcıdır. Kanıtlayıcı, doğrulayıcıya belirli bilgilere sahip olduğunu veya bildiğini kanıtlamak zorundadır, ancak belirli ayrıntıları ifşa etmeden.
İkincisi, zk-SNARKs'in Ana Türleri
Şu anda, zk-SNARKs esas olarak iki ana kategoriye ayrılmaktadır:
Yaygın ZKP sistemleri şunlardır:
Üç, zk-SNARKs'in teknik prensipleri
ZKP'nin temel fikri, hesaplama problemlerini çok terimli problemlere dönüştürmektir. Ana adımlar şunlardır:
zk-SNARK ve zk-STARK gibi sistemlerin somut uygulamalarında farklılıklar vardır, ancak temel prensipleri benzer.
Dört, zk-SNARKs Uygulama Senaryoları
ZKP'nin blok zinciri alanında geniş bir uygulama potansiyeli vardır:
Beş, zk-SNARKs ekosisteminin genel görünümü
Şu anda ZKP ekosistemi esasen aşağıdaki birkaç proje türünü içermektedir:
Ana akım halka açık blok zincirleri, Ethereum gibi, ZKP teknolojisini aktif bir şekilde benimsemekte ve bunu gelecekteki genişleme için önemli bir yön olarak görmektedir.
Altı, zk-SNARKs'in Zorlukları ve Geleceği
ZKP teknolojisi geniş bir geleceğe sahip olmasına rağmen, hala bazı zorluklarla karşı karşıya.
Gelecekte, teknolojinin sürekli ilerlemesi ve ekosistemin giderek daha da mükemmel hale gelmesiyle, ZKP'nin daha fazla alanda önemli bir rol oynaması ve blockchain ile Web3'ün büyük ölçekli uygulamalarını teşvik etmesi bekleniyor.